Deciphering the meaning and significance of web-based Customer Relationship Management (CRM) systems is crucial in today’s digital landscape. Understanding its core components and potential impact can empower businesses to leverage this technology effectively, ultimately leading to improved customer interactions, streamlined operations, and increased profitability.

Data Centralization

Consolidates customer information from various sources into a single, accessible repository.

Enhanced Communication

Facilitates personalized and timely communication with customers across multiple channels.

Improved Customer Service

Provides a comprehensive view of customer interactions, enabling efficient and effective service delivery.

Sales Process Optimization

Streamlines sales processes, from lead generation to deal closure, enhancing sales team productivity.

Marketing Campaign Effectiveness

Enables targeted marketing campaigns based on customer segmentation and behavior analysis.

Increased Efficiency and Productivity

Automates routine tasks, freeing up valuable time for employees to focus on strategic initiatives.

Better Reporting and Analytics

Provides real-time insights into key performance indicators (KPIs), facilitating data-driven decision-making.

Improved Collaboration

Breaks down silos and fosters collaboration between different departments within an organization.

Scalability and Flexibility

Adapts to evolving business needs and scales effortlessly as the customer base grows.

Cost-Effectiveness

Reduces operational costs by automating tasks and optimizing resource allocation.

Tips for Successful Implementation

Define Clear Objectives

Establish specific, measurable, achievable, relevant, and time-bound (SMART) goals for CRM implementation.

Choose the Right CRM System

Select a system that aligns with the organization’s specific needs and budget.

Provide Adequate Training

Ensure that all users are properly trained on how to use the CRM system effectively.

Data Migration and Integration

Plan and execute a seamless data migration strategy from existing systems to the new CRM platform.

Frequently Asked Questions

What are the key benefits of using a web-based CRM?

Accessibility, cost-effectiveness, scalability, and enhanced collaboration are some of the key advantages.

How does a web-based CRM improve customer relationships?

By providing a centralized view of customer data, facilitating personalized communication, and enabling efficient service delivery.

What are the typical features of a web-based CRM?

Contact management, sales automation, marketing automation, customer service management, and reporting and analytics are common features.

How can a business choose the right web-based CRM system?

Consider factors such as business needs, budget, scalability requirements, and integration capabilities.

What is the role of data security in a web-based CRM?

Protecting sensitive customer data is paramount, and robust security measures are essential for any web-based CRM system.
